๐Ÿ› ๏ธ Technical Deep Dive

  • Canon's DIGIC X and newer image processors utilize high-bandwidth LPDDR5 memory to handle the massive data throughput required for 45MP+ sensors and 8K/60p RAW video recording.
  • The increased memory cost is tied to the industry-wide shift toward HBM (High Bandwidth Memory) and advanced DRAM nodes, which have seen price hikes due to AI-driven demand in the data center sector.
  • Canon's camera architecture relies on a multi-tier memory hierarchy (on-chip SRAM + external DRAM) to maintain burst shooting speeds of up to 30fps, making them highly sensitive to DRAM spot price fluctuations.
